Financial health, per its FY2023 accounts

The accounts state that the charity reported a net deficit of £20,335 for the year ended 31 December 2023, following a deficit of £51,138 in the prior year. Total reserves stood at £585,262, with free reserves (readily available funds) amounting to just £4,975. The trustees consider current reserve levels adequate but note the need to rebuild the general reserve to £60,000 to cover emergency expenditure.
